Does Blood Scale off Arcane?
The answer to whether Blood scales off Arcane is yes, but with specific conditions: Blood Loss build-up scales with Arcane if the weapon has Arcane scaling and a bleed passive, or if Arcane scaling is added to the weapon using a Blood, Poison, or Occult Enhancement. This means that investing in Arcane can significantly increase the effectiveness of Bleed builds in games like Elden Ring, making Arcane a crucial stat for players focusing on Bleed damage.
Understanding Arcane and its Effects
To delve deeper into the relationship between Arcane and Blood scaling, it’s essential to understand what Arcane represents in the context of Elden Ring and similar games. Arcane is a stat that affects various aspects of gameplay, including the build-up of status effects like Bleed, Poison, and Madness.
Arcane’s Role in Status Effect Build-up
Arcane plays a critical role in increasing the build-up rate of status effects, making it a key stat for players who prefer to use Bleed or Poison-based strategies. The effectiveness of Arcane in scaling Blood damage is most notable when used in conjunction with weapons that have innate Arcane scaling or when Arcane scaling is applied through enhancements.

- How much Arcane should I have for a Bleed build?
- Aim for at least 45 Arcane for a Bleed build, as it’s around the soft cap for Bleed build-up.
- Is Dex or Arcane better for Bleeding?
- Arcane is the primary stat for Bleed builds, but Dexterity is also important, especially for weapons with Dex scaling.
- How to scale Blood Loss or Bleed scaling in Elden Ring?
- Blood Loss scales with Arcane when using weapons with Arcane scaling and a bleed passive, or with Occult Enhancement.

- Does Arcane help with Blood build?
- Yes, Arcane affects the build-up of Blood Loss and other status effects when using applicable weapons or enhancements.
- Does Arcane affect Bloody Slash?
- Yes, Bloody Slash scales with Arcane, making it more powerful with increased Arcane levels.
- Does Arcane give more Bleed damage?
- Arcane increases Bleed buildup but does not directly give more Bleed damage unless the weapon has Arcane scaling and a bleed passive.

- Which incantations scale with Arcane?
- Dragon Communion incantations, among others, scale with Arcane when using the Dragon Communion Seal.
- What weapon scales best with Arcane?
- Weapons like Rivers of Blood, Varre’s Bouquet, and Eleonora’s Poleblade are known for their Arcane scaling.
- Do any seals scale with Arcane?
- Yes, the Dragon Communion Seal scales primarily with Faith and Arcane.
